Continuing Legal Education CLES
This series will consist of twelve seminars, each of which will cover a different topic. The purpose of these seminars is to provide relevant, timely information and qualifying continuing professional education credit hours for attorneys and accountants. Accurate records of attendance will be maintained to verify and report the continuing education credit hours.
Attorneys are awarded one credit for every 60 minutes of classroom attendance. Upon completion, a verification letter of continuing education credit hours earned will be mailed to each participant.

Cancellations and Refunds
Payment is due upon registration. Students may request a registration cancellation through the start date of the course. A $25 cancellation fee will apply. No refunds will be given for withdrawal requests after the course start date. The University reserves the right to cancel course selections. If the course is cancelled, the student will be issued a full refund.
